How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Redwood City?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Redwood City Studio Apartments | $3,212 | $1,875 | $4,104 |
| Redwood City 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,731 | $2,150 | $8,613 |
| Redwood City 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,879 | $2,650 | $10,000+ |
| Redwood City 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,616 | $4,030 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Redwood City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Redwood City?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Redwood City is at Monticello listed at $2,095.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Redwood City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Redwood City is $4,424.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Redwood City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Redwood City is a 2,100 square feet unit starting from $2,414 at Hillsdale Garden.
What is the average size for Redwood City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Redwood City is currently at 641 sq ft.
